        "rendered": "<p><strong>Q: What significant change is being introduced regarding official Vatican documents?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>A: Official Vatican documents can now be drafted in languages other than Latin, a historic shift from Latin being the default.<\/p>\n\n<p><strong>Q: What is the primary purpose of the new General and Personnel Regulations of the Roman Curia?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>A: The regulations aim to adapt the internal functioning of Vatican bodies to the apostolic constitution Praedicate Evangelium and consolidate an ecclesial service with a pastoral and missionary character.<\/p>\n\n<p><strong>Q: What measures are being implemented to prevent nepotism within Vatican offices?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>A: Nepotism is addressed by prohibiting the hiring of close blood relatives (up to the fourth degree) and first\/second-degree relatives by marriage within the same entity.<\/p>\n\n<p><strong>Q: How do the new regulations address financial transparency for Vatican officials?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>A: Officials are required to declare every two years that they do not own assets in &#8220;tax havens&#8221; or hold shares in companies contradicting Church social doctrine.<\/p>\n\n<p><strong>Q: What new retirement age guidelines are being established for Curia positions?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>A: Heads of dicasteries will retire at 75, lay employees at 70, and ecclesiastical and religious undersecretaries at 72, with all positions automatically terminating at age 80.<\/p>\n\nThis is a summary of the article from https:\/\/ewtnvatican.com\/articles\/vatican-curia-documents-non-latin-languages.
